匡扶文件太多太烦?大牛教你怎样将latex 编译目录变得干净清爽

辅助文件太多太烦?大牛教你怎样将latex 编译目录变得干净清爽

WinEdt 是用latex 写文档的人都经常会用一个编辑编译集成环境。虽然好用,但总是会在当前工作目录下生成很多辅助文件,给人一种很烦的感觉,尤其是像笔者这样带点轻微强迫症的人。你当然可以每次编译完就把用不到的文件删掉,但会很影响效率。而且有些文件是下次编译也可能会用到的,比如 aux 文件和 bbl 文件。那么怎样把这些文件去掉而又不影响工作效率呢?

 

方法其实很多。这里笔者介绍一种比较简单的方法。在 Options ->  Execution Modes 里,

找到第一个选项卡里的 latex (就是第一个),在 Switches 里追加 --output-directory=C:\Users\Arthur\AppData\Roaming\Latex

找到 bibtex 在 Parameters 里修改为 "C:\Users\Arthur\AppData\Roaming\Latex\%N"

找到 dvi2pdf 修改 Paramters 为 "C:\Users\Arthur\AppData\Roaming\Latex\%N.dvi"

 

这样就可以先用 latex 命令产生 dvi 文件,再用 dvi2pdf 产生 pdf 文件。唯一的影响就是该 dvi 文件将无法再用 DVI Preview 查看,只能每次完全编译成pdf 再查看。

 

参考:http://tex.stackexchange.com/questions/11765/having-pdflatex-clean-up-after-itself-in-winedt